When you accept your offer of admission, you will be required to pay a non-refundable acceptance deposit in your Student Service Centre (SSC).
Your acceptance deposit counts as your first registration deposit, and will be applied to your tuition fees after you register for classes. Read about acceptance deposits in the Academic Calendar.
If you’re a graduate student, your program will let you know if you need to pay a registration deposit.
Paying your acceptance deposit
Interac® Online payment
Interac® Online is available for Canadian accounts at the following financial institutions:
- Scotiabank
- RBC Royal Bank
- TD Canada Trust
- BMO
Log into your Student Service Centre (SSC) and select the “Interac” option in “Pay Fees” under Finances. Successful payments will be processed immediately through the SSC, but can take several days for it be processed from your bank account.
VISA debit cards cannot be used with Interac® Online. You will also need to confirm with your financial institution that your daily Interac® limit will be enough to cover your payment.
Credit card online payment
To pay with your credit card online, log into your Student Service Centre (SSC) and select “Credit Card” in “Pay Fees” under Finances. Successful payments will be processed immediately.
